Tyler Time: Hansbrough willed Tar Heels to a victory
Posted Mar 30, 2008
Late last night the Tar Heels threatened to hit history’s rewind button, their short-armed jump shots and persistent fouls dredging up memories of Georgetown and the messy collapse last March. Tyler Hansbrough would have none of that. Everybody’s All-America wanted nobody else taking the fall against Louisville. He took the ball, took the shots and took Carolina to the Final Four, scoring 28 points in an 83-73 victory.
